The US Coast Guard needs a small business to manufacture boat capture nets for the Coast Guard.

Key Details

  • What exactly do they need?

The Coast Guard needs a custom boat capture net with specific materials and features, including a 904PME and 901PME polyester web, a 2-inch nylon double braid rope, and a 3/8" UV-resistant bungee cord. The net must be individually packaged and meet specific packaging and shipping requirements.

  • What's the contract structure and timeline?

This is a brand name basis procurement, meaning only products manufactured by LIFT-IT MANUFACTURING CO., INC. will be accepted. The contract is for a single delivery of 6 units.

  • How will they pick the winner?

The Coast Guard will evaluate proposals based on the vendor's ability to meet the specifications and provide the required documentation.

  • When and how do you bid?

Submit your proposal through SAM.gov by June 22, 2026, at 5:00 PM ET.
